I'm in reality shows as I am loud: Sambhavna Seth

Bollywood item girl Sambhavna Seth who has been a part of many reality shows like "Bigg Boss", "Dil Jeetegi Desi Girl", "Welcome - Baazi Mehmaan-Nawazi Ki", says that people like to take her in reality shows as they feel she is loud and aggressive.

The actress also added that due to this image, it often gets tough for her to get acting assignments.

"'Bigg Boss' had this image of me which was all out and full of anger. So due to that image of mine, to get work in films or acting, it gets tough. You are fixed in a certain image. Even for reality shows, they take me because they feel I am loud and hyper," she told IANS.

Sambhavna was shown to be this way in "Bigg Boss" but said that there are many more sides to her, which no one has shown on screen.

"They don't think that I can have another side too. I think I am very different in real life. People think that she is negative or the audience have accpeted her like that. But people's memory is shot and they believe what they are shown," she said.

But having said that, the actress still feels proud to be a part of a show like "Bigg Boss" and said that she owes everything to that show.

"I started off with a big reality show which was 'Bigg Boss'. That experience I did not get anywhere else. It was a life time experience. For me, I still feel very proud...whatever I am is because of it. I have done shows after that, it has been a good journey," she said.

After being a part of so many reality shows, the actress does admit that they often become stressful as there are many emotions which emerge.

"Reality shows are stressful, they have emotions which come out in anger or when I cry. For me, Bigg Boss was also very stressful. But it has given me everything...money, fame, house, car. I feel very nice," she said.
